In addition, you can view your complete inventory over the <br /> internet with RS-Web. <br /> The same standards of guaranteed quality apply to our digital management services. At <br /> no time during an imaging project will accessibility of records be disrupted. To ensure a <br /> complete conversion with the highest quality we have processes in place for identification, <br /> transportation, preparation, digitization, quality control and confidential destruction of records <br /> and files. During the scanning process, we guarantee 100% delivery satisfaction of requested <br /> files. A history of activity is maintained documenting who requests information, when it was <br /> requested, and when it is returned to a facility. <br /> Once scanned, all data is guaranteed to be exported in a useful manner, as directed by <br /> OCES. Images will be individually compared to originals in a rigorous QC process and indexed <br /> according to direction. <br /> Additionally, as a free service, Starpoint will permanently store a copy of all images and <br /> indexes for disaster recovery. This backup will be stored in our secure HVAC vault in Chapel <br /> Hill,NC, and tested on an annual basis for consistency. <br /> The combination of professional accurate scanning/imaging and 24 years of experience in file <br /> management is a distinct advantage that Starpoint can offer OCES. <br /> Scope of Work <br /> All-Inclusive Intake and Inventory <br /> •Deliver any chart or file needed by OCES during normal business hours for the duration of <br /> the scanning process. <br /> •Provide all personnel and equipment to pack the charts and transport them to Starpoint's <br /> information management facility." <br /> •Establish authorized access and OCES users. <br /> **Containers are available to OCES at charge of$1.00 each(60%discount).Inclusive coverage of packing and transport applies only to <br /> simple packing of records straight off of shelves.Selective pulls and purging projects will result in$23.00/hour labor charge. <br /> Digital Conversion <br /> •Files will be prepped for feeding into the scanners by removing paper clips, staples and <br /> post-it notes, copying and repairing damaged pages, and demarcating individual visits. <br /> •Starpoint will image all pages at full duplex mode with our Ultrasonic Multi-Feed Detection <br /> equipped Bowe Bell +Howell scanners to ensure a 100%capture rate. <br /> •Images will be scanned at 200 dpi in TIFF Group IV format files for interoperability. <br /> Following scanning, a set of image and manipulation processes will be run to remove blank <br /> pages, correct skewed images, and remove black borders. <br /> Page 4 <br />
